The story is set approximately seven years after the end of HPMOR, and Harry has already revolutionized the wizarding world. Despite this, not all is well. The Tower School of Doubt is opposed in its efforts to abolish death by a reactionary coalition of the "Honourable", lead by Draco Malfoy. Hermione Granger and those she has returned from Dementation continue to raise havoc in their quest to destroy Dementors, no matter how the wizarding governments of the world feel about it. And at the center remains Harry, still bound by an Unbreakable Vow, trying to unite the world and reach the stars.
